C-Store Clerk Accused of Running over Theft Suspect with His Car

An employee at a Salt Lake City 7-Eleven store has been arrested on suspicion of running over a retail theft suspect with his car. According to a probable cause statement, Ronald James Kirkham, 60, attempted to stop the suspect who fled the store on foot Tuesday. Kirkham got into his personal vehicle and followed the suspect in an attempt to detain him for police.

During that process, Kirkham “struck the retail theft suspect (victim) with his vehicle, driving over his legs, and then proceeded to crash the vehicle into the neighboring home, causing severe structural damage,” the statement said. Kirkham then left the scene with his vehicle and called 911.

Officers contacted Kirkham and booked him into the Salt Lake County jail on suspicion of aggravated assault resulting in serious bodily injury, a felony, and other suspected crimes…  Fox13
